Simon C wrote a great description how to remove the ignition lock.
But I do not understand the phrase:
"Push detent on top of the lock barrel with a small screwdriver"
 
Is there a screw? Where exactly is this "barrel" to unlock the lock?
Simon C wrote (very encouraging for me) that this operation is very straitforward. I like to believe him.  
 
Any suggestions are welcome.

It is quite difficult to see, but on top of the barrrel there is a little pin type thing that you have to push in with a small screwdriver or implement, once that is pushed in you will be able to slide the barrel out

Hi,
 
at the top of the ignition lock (facing up towards the windscreen), when you turn the key to position 1 you will be able to push a little tab which will give slightly and the lock will pop out. You may not be able to see it very well but it is there, and you will need a small screwdriver to push the tab, like the size for tightening glasses.

Here is a picture of an ignition barrel already removed in, I think, the same position as it is in the car.
 

 
That circular silver button is what needs to be pushed in order for the barrel to release. It can only be pushed in ignition position 1, the top plastic cover of the steering column needs to be removed in order to do it, and the barrel should just pop out slightly when you push it - you can then withdraw it completely.
 
The button has to be pushed from above, I find it best to feel for it with my finger then push it with a small screwdriver. I am afraid I am not near the car to take a picture of it in situ.
 
The key will have to be in position 1 to refit it.
